Example Data Table
Parameter Input Unit Key Output
Total Alkalinity 120 ppm (as CaCO3) 6.86 meq/L
Calcium Hardness 10 °fH 100 ppm (as CaCO3)
Free Chlorine 3.0 ppm 6.75 ppm Bromine eq.

These examples show typical conversions for water care and garden systems.

Formula Used

Hardness-style conversions treat readings as calcium carbonate equivalents:

  • meq/L = ppm ÷ 50 because 1 meq/L equals 50 mg/L as CaCO3.
  • dKH = ppm ÷ 17.848 and °dH = ppm ÷ 17.848.
  • gpg = ppm ÷ 17.1 for grains per gallon.
  • °fH = ppm ÷ 10 for French hardness degrees.

Sanitizer equivalence uses a common pool/spa rule of thumb:

  • Bromine (ppm) ≈ Chlorine (ppm) × 2.25
  • Chlorine (ppm) ≈ Bromine (ppm) ÷ 2.25
